The global Corn Starch Derivatives market was valued at US$ 5.13 billion in 2023 and is predicted to reach US$ 7.81 billion by 2030, exhibiting a Compound Annual Growth Rate (CAGR) of 6.2% during the forecast period (2023-2030). This growth trajectory reflects rising demand across food processing, pharmaceuticals, and industrial applications, driven by starch’s functional versatility and cost-effective production advantages.
Corn starch derivatives are modified through enzymatic, chemical, or physical processes to enhance properties like solubility, viscosity, and thermal stability. Market Overview & Regional Analysis
North America currently leads in high-value specialty starch production, holding 38% of global capacity. The region’s dominance stems from advanced R&D in resistant starches and widespread adoption in gluten-free products. However, Asia-Pacific is gaining ground rapidly with China alone accounting for 28% of global corn starch output, supported by favorable government policies for agricultural processing.
Europe maintains leadership in sustainable starch derivatives, with 72% of producers certified for organic/bio-based production. Latin America shows exceptional growth in modified starches for meat processing, while the Middle East emerges as a key importer for pharmaceutical-grade derivatives. Africa’s market remains nascent but presents long-term potential as local food processing expands.
Key Market Drivers and Opportunities
The market is propelled by three transformative trends: clean-label reformulation in F&B (62% of manufacturers now list starch derivatives), expansion of bio-pharmaceutical excipients, and innovative industrial applications like biodegradable packaging. The shift toward plant-based ingredients opens new horizons, particularly for waxy maize derivatives in vegan dairy alternatives.
Emerging opportunities cluster around:
- Precision fermentation techniques for high-purity pharmaceutical starches
- Co-processing with pulse flours for enhanced nutritional profiles
- Nanostarch applications in drug delivery systems
The personal care sector shows remarkable potential, with starch-based alternatives replacing microplastics in exfoliants and emulsifiers.
Challenges & Restraints
Volatile corn prices (fluctuating 18-22% annually) continue to pressure margins, compounded by rising energy costs for spray drying processes. Regulatory fragmentation poses hurdles – while Europe emphasizes E-number approvals, Asian markets face inconsistent food safety standards. Technical limitations in acid-thinned starches and supply chain bottlenecks for specialty modifications present ongoing challenges.
